Understanding Cryptocurrency

At its core, cryptocurrency is a digital or virtual form of currency that uses cryptography for security. The first and most well-known cryptocurrency, Bitcoin, was created in 2009, paving the way for thousands of other cryptocurrencies, each with unique features and use cases. Cryptocurrencies operate on decentralized networks based on blockchain technology, which ensures transparency, security, and immutability. This decentralization eliminates the need for intermediaries, allowing for peer-to-peer transactions and opening up new avenues for economic interaction.

Defining the Metaverse

The metaverse is an expansive, interconnected virtual universe where users can interact with each other and digital environments in real-time. It encompasses a range of experiences, from immersive virtual reality (VR) worlds to augmented reality (AR) overlays that blend the digital and physical realms. In the metaverse, users can create, own, and trade digital assets, leading to a new economy driven by creativity, social interactions, and innovation. It is a space where the boundaries of reality are blurred, allowing individuals to express themselves in ways that were previously unimaginable.

The Synergy Between Cryptocurrency and the Metaverse

The convergence of cryptocurrency and the metaverse is an exciting development that has the potential to reshape not just how we view digital assets but also how we engage in various aspects of life, including work, play, and socialization. Here are several key areas where these two concepts intersect:

1. Digital Ownership and NFTs

Non-fungible tokens (NFTs) have gained enormous traction as a method for establishing ownership of unique digital assets within the metaverse. These tokens are built on blockchain technology and can represent anything from virtual real estate to digital art or in-game items. As users navigate through the metaverse, NFTs allow them to buy, sell, and trade these assets securely. Furthermore, the integration of cryptocurrencies as a medium of exchange within the metaverse makes transactions seamless and efficient.

2. Economic Ecosystems

The metaverse is rapidly developing into a vibrant economic ecosystem where users can earn a living through various means, such as creating digital content, offering services, or trading virtual goods. Cryptocurrencies serve as the backbone of this new economy, providing a universal currency that facilitates transactions across different platforms and experiences. By leveraging blockchain technology, these economies can ensure transparency, reduce fraud, and empower users to control their own financial destinies.

3. Decentralized Governance and Communities

Dec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s) are communities governed by smart contracts on blockchain networks. In the context of the metaverse, DAOs enable users to participate in decision-making processes regarding the development and evolution of virtual spaces. This decentralized governance model fosters a sense of belonging and ownership among users, allowing them to shape their environments in line with collective interests. Cryptocurrency often plays a crucial role in these governance structures, as users may need to hold specific tokens to participate in votes or access certain features.

Challenges and Considerations

While the intersection of cryptocurrency and the metaverse presents exciting opportunities, it is not without its challenges. Key considerations include:

1. Regulatory Landscape

The regulatory environment surrounding cryptocurrencies is still evolving, with governments and financial institutions grappling with how to approach this new frontier. As the metaverse continues to grow, regulatory frameworks will need to adapt to address issues such as taxation, consumer protection, and anti-money laundering. Navigating these regulations will be crucial for the sustainable growth of both cryptocurrency and the metaverse.

2. Security and Privacy

With the rise of digital assets comes the heightened risk of cyber threats, including hacking, fraud, and theft. Users must be vigilant in protecting their assets and personal information as they engage in the metaverse. Strengthening security measures, utilizing secure wallets, and understanding the risks associated with transactions are essential steps for participants in this space.

3. Accessibility and Inclusivity

As the metaverse becomes increasingly intertwined with cryptocurrency, it is vital to ensure that these technologies remain accessible to everyone. Bridging the digital divide and providing educational resources will be critical to fostering a diverse and inclusive metaverse that empowers individuals from all backgrounds.
